Dodge Journey is getting rebadged as the Fiat Freemont for Europe
You might as well get used to this. Cross-pollination and re-badging between Chrysler and Fiat is going to move on apace in 2011 and this is just the start, with the recently re-fettled Dodge Journey being tweaked and re-badged for Europe as the Fiat Freemont. Sergio Marchionne sees the Journey doing much better in Europe badged as a Fiat, and he’s probably right.
Peugeot has revealed that the new 208 GTI will cost from £18,895, with the order book for the 208 GTi opening in March. That price will be £18,895 – almost £2k more than the new Fiesta ST - and includes the usual GTi stuff like 17″ alloys, new grill, LED running lights, twin exhausts, leather and cloth upholstery, red trim details, DAB, rear parking and a smattering of GTi badges. Peugeot also say that the 208 GTi has been fettled to make it a more sporty prospect than the standard 208, with retuned suspension and wider track.
